NISSIN HISTORY

2020’s
2024
JUNE
Changed the size of Cup Noodles in Thailand to match the specification of Japan Cup Noodles
2021
SEPTEMBER
Achieved sale of 50 billion meals worldwide on 50th anniversary of Cup Noodles
2020
DEECEMBER
Nissin Foods (ASIA) Pte Ltd. Shift to Thailand
2017
August
Launch GEKI Series(Spicy) in Thailand market
2016
AUGUST
Introduced Eco Cup in Thailand market, which is not hot to hold, non-slippable and environmentally friendly.
MARCH
Cumulative sales of the Cup Noodles brand worldwide reach 40 billion servings
MARCH
Completion of "the WAVE", a new research and development center at Hachioji, Japan
2013
JULY
Completion of NISSIN THAILAND Factory at Navanakorn, Pathumthani
2011
SEPTEMBER
Opening of the CUPNOODLES MUSEUM at Yokohama, Japan
JULY
Cumulative sales of Cup Noodles in Japan reach 20 billion servings.
2010’s
2009
October
Establishment of Nissin Foods (Asia) Pte Ltd. at Singapore
2008
OCTOBER
Transition to a holding company structure
2007
JANUARY
Passing of NISSIN FOODS founder Momofuku Ando
2005
JULY
Journey of Space Ram into space together with astronaut Soichi Noguchi
2000’s
1999
NOVEMBER
Opening of the Momofuku Ando Instant Ramen Museum at Osaka, Japan
1995
JANUARY
Cumulative sales of Cup Noodles in Japan reach 10 billion servings.
1994
JANUARY
Establishment of Nissin Foods (Thailand) Co., Ltd. The construction of a plant is completed in Sriracha, Chonburi in November
1993
JUNE
The "hungry?" TV commercial series wins Grand Prix at the Cannes Lions International Advertising Festival
1970’s
1971
SEPTEMBER
Introduction of Cup Noodles, the world's first cup-type instant noodles
1950’s
1958
AUGUST
Introduction of Chicken Ramen, the world's first instant noodles
